Trafford close to Leeds as Newcastle drop out of the race

Trafford close to Leeds, Newcastle out

James Trafford is heading to Elland Road. Leeds United are in talks with City and the goalkeeper is leaning towards the switch, with Newcastle United stepping aside (3) (6) (7). The deal is gathering pace and Trafford looks set to leave this summer.

Guardiola set to reject Italy and keep his break going

The Italian federation have spoken to Pep Guardiola about the national team job, but he is expected to turn it down and extend his coaching break (2) (5). Carlo Ancelotti was also on the FIGC shortlist. Guardiola is staying away from football for now.

Agbonlahor: Grealish will leave the league

Gabby Agbonlahor believes Jack Grealish will exit the Premier League after his Everton loan spell (4). The former Villa striker made the claim in a radio appearance, though no concrete interest has surfaced yet.

Elsewhere, a reminder of the academy's absurd output: Chelsea have spent nearly £300m on six former City academy graduates since 2023, which has fans feeling vindicated rather than bitter.
